The smiling build-up to the weekend’s bout took an ugly turn yesterday when a face-to-face photo opportunity between Ricky Hatton and Floyd Mayweather Jr ended in a shoving match and insults.
The two were brought together for photographers at the end of their final press conference and after standing toe-to-toe for two minutes the pair started shoving and swapping abuse, before Hatton made a throat-slitting gesture towards Mayweather. “He leaned on me a little bit, I just leaned back on him and he spat his dummy out,” Hatton said. “The fight is two days away now and I’ve done my laughing and joking. When I leaned back on him he said, ‘don’t touch me, don’t touch me’. I gave him a bit of a ‘you’re dead’ gesture. If he’s upset at that, just wait until the bell rings.”
Leonard Ellerbe, Mayweather’s manager, separated the pair and held the American back, but it was the “Pretty Boy” who seemed the more upset.
